You are right, Cely. Thanks for your comment and sorry to have seen it so late. It is from one of my early photos in the 1980s, copied with a recent digital camera to make this file. I was experimenting with Kodak infrared b&w film on the boardwalk in front of the Chateau Frontenac hotel in Quebec City and was intrigued by the variety of citizens that walk or rest there (the gentleman in the more traditional suit was often seen in town, alone, quietly taking his walks- I like how, accidentally, he is contrasted with the men to the left and right in modern casual garb), and some of the younger persons played popular music under one of the gazebos.
